Open top-level national domain names to free-trade or risk backlash, says Tucows

News | 07/26/2000 4:00 am EDT

A prominent communications lawyer is calling for free-trade in top-level Internet domain names, warning that restrictive Canadian policies will trigger trade retaliation for domestic companies working abroad.
